One of the standout features of the CURT 13241 is its dependable strength. With a gross trailer weight rating of 5,000 lbs and a tongue weight capacity of 500 lbs, this hitch is built to handle substantial loads. Additionally, it boasts an impressive weight distribution capacity of 8,000 lbs, ensuring that I can tow trailers, boats, or even a camper without worrying about safety or stability. Safety is paramount when it comes to towing, and CURT has taken this seriously by ensuring that every design is rigorously tested. Each CURT class 3 trailer hitch is evaluated under real-world conditions at their Detroit engineering facility, adhering to SAE J684 standards. Moreover, I appreciate the durability of the CURT 13241. The unique dual-coat finish of rust-resistant liquid A-coat and a highly durable black powder coat provides exceptional protection against rust, chipping, and UV rays. One of the standout features of this trailer hitch is its construction. Made from solid, all-welded steel, I appreciate the maximum strength and safety it offers. Knowing that each hitch undergoes rigorous fatigue and stress testing gives me peace of mind, especially when I’m on the road. The two-part black powder coat finish not only enhances its durability but also resists rust and corrosion, ensuring that it remains in top condition for years to come, regardless of the weather conditions I might face.
Moreover, the Draw-Tite hitch is rigorously tested to meet and exceed V-5 and SAE J684 standards. This level of testing reassures me that it’s built to handle the challenges of towing without compromising safety. With a towing capacity rated for up to 5,000 lbs. GTW and a tongue weight of up to 750 lbs., it opens up a world of possibilities for transporting larger loads. For those who might require even more capability, this hitch is also suitable for use with Weight Distribution systems, accommodating up to 8,000 lbs. WD and 800 lbs. WDTW. Nissan Frontier Trailer Hitch Buying Guide
Understanding My Needs
Before diving into the world of trailer hitches for my Nissan Frontier, I took a moment to assess my specific towing needs. I considered what I planned to tow, whether it was a small boat, a trailer for camping, or a utility trailer for moving. Knowing the weight and type of the load helped me determine the appropriate hitch class I needed.
Choosing the Right Hitch Class
The hitch class is crucial for ensuring safe towing. I found that there are several classes, each designed for different weight capacities. For my Nissan Frontier, I explored Class III and Class IV hitches, which can handle a good range of towing capacities. Understanding these classifications allowed me to make an informed decision based on my towing requirements.
Compatibility with My Nissan Frontier
I made sure to check the compatibility of the hitch with my specific model year of the Nissan Frontier. Each model can have different specifications, so I referenced my vehicle’s manual and consulted compatibility charts. This step was essential to ensure a proper fit and secure towing.
Material and Construction Quality
When selecting a trailer hitch, I focused on the material and construction quality. I preferred hitches made from heavy-duty steel, as they offer better durability and resistance to wear and tear. I also looked for hitches that are powder-coated to prevent rust and corrosion, ensuring longevity in various weather conditions.
Installation Options
I considered my installation preferences as well. Some hitches come with a straightforward bolt-on installation process, which I found appealing. However, I also noted that some may require welding or additional modifications to my vehicle. I weighed the pros and cons of each installation method, factoring in my level of expertise and the tools I had available.
Weight Distribution and Sway Control
For a safer towing experience, I researched weight distribution and sway control options. These features help manage the load balance and reduce the risk of swaying while driving. Understanding how these systems work gave me peace of mind that my towing would be stable and secure.
Legal Requirements and Ratings
I also took the time to familiarize myself with local towing regulations and weight ratings. Knowing the legal limits for towing in my area ensured that I stayed within safe parameters. Additionally, I checked the hitch’s rating to ensure it met or exceeded the weight of my intended load.
Additional Accessories
I considered various accessories that could enhance my towing experience. Items like a wiring harness for trailer lights, a hitch lock for security, and a ball mount to connect the trailer were on my list. These accessories help streamline the towing process and increase safety.
Warranty and Customer Support
Finally, I looked into the warranty and customer support offered by the hitch manufacturer. A solid warranty gives me confidence in my purchase, while responsive customer support can be invaluable if I encounter any issues during installation or use.
